Abstract

The embodiment of the invention provides a centrifugal fan impeller and a centrifugal fan, and relates to the technical field of pelletizing equipment. The centrifugal fan impeller comprises an impeller body and a wear-resistant composite steel plate, the wear-resistant composite steel plate comprises a base layer and a wear-resistant layer, the base layer is arranged on the surface of the impeller body, and the wear-resistant layer is arranged on the surface of the base layer; wherein the wear-resistant layer comprises 3%-4.5% of carbon, 25%-30% of chromium, 0.5%-1.5% of manganese and 0.5%-1.5% of silicon. By adding carbon, chromium, manganese and silicon elements into the wear-resistant layer of the wear-resistant composite steel plate and controlling the content of the corresponding elements, the elements interact and cooperate, the wear resistance, corrosion resistance and high-temperature oxidation resistance of the wear-resistant layer can be improved, the overall structural stability of the fan impeller is improved, and the service life of the fan impeller is prolonged.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of pelletizing equipment, in particular to a centrifugal fan impeller and a centrifugal fan. BACKGROUND

[0002] The heat-resistant centrifugal fan is an important equipment of the pellet chain kiln finished product system, which mainly functions to pump the hot flue gas in the preheating II section of the chain grate machine to the drying section of the chain grate machine to remove the moisture in the green pellets, so that the green pellets can withstand the temperature above 650 DEG C in the preheating I section. A multi-tube dust collector is installed between the preheating II section and the heat-resistant centrifugal fan to remove the dust particles in the exhaust gas and reduce the dust concentration in the exhaust gas.

[0003] With the increase of the feeding amount of the pellet chain grate machine, the dust concentration in the preheating II section increases, and the dust removal efficiency of the multi-tube dust collector decreases, which significantly increases the dust concentration in the working medium of the centrifugal fan impeller, and further aggravates the wear problem of the rotor blades. Therefore, the existing technology usually provides a wear plate on the impeller. However, the current wear plate still has the problems of insufficient wear resistance, corrosion resistance and high-temperature oxidation resistance, which affects the structural stability and service life of the fan impeller. [0028] The embodiment provides a centrifugal fan, which comprises a fan body and a centrifugal fan impeller 100 arranged in the fan body.

[0029] Please refer to Figure 1 and Figure 2 , Figure 1 The first view structural diagram of the centrifugal fan impeller 100 provided by the embodiment is shown in the figure, Figure 2 The second view structural diagram of the centrifugal fan impeller 100 provided by the embodiment is shown in the figure. In combination with Figure 1 and Figure 2 The centrifugal fan impeller 100 comprises an impeller body 10 and a w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 arranged on the surface of the impeller body 10.

[0030] Specifically, please refer to Figure 3 , Figure 3 The structural diagram of the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 provided by the embodiment is shown in the figure. In combination with Figures 1-3 The w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 comprises a base layer 31 arranged on the surface of the impeller body 10 and a wear-resistant layer 32 arranged on the surface of the base layer 31. The carbon content of the wear-resistant layer 32 is 3-4.5%, the chromium content is 25-30%, the manganese content is 0.5-1.5%, and the silicon content is 0.5-1.5%.

[0031] It can be understood that, by adding carbon, chromium, manganese and silicon elements in the wear-resistant layer 32 of the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 and controlling the content of the corresponding elements, the wear-resistant layer 32 can improve the wear resistance, corrosion resistance and high-temperature oxidation resistance of the wear-resistant layer 32, thereby improving the overall structural stability of the centrifugal fan impeller 100 and prolonging the service life of the centrifugal fan impeller 100.

[0032] It should be noted that the main material in the wear-resistant layer 32 is steel, and the remaining material elements are carbon, chromium, manganese and silicon. Specifically, by adding manganese elements and controlling the content, the wear-resistant performance of the wear-resistant layer 32 can be enhanced; meanwhile, the manganese and chromium elements are matched, and the content of the two elements is controlled, so that the high-temperature corrosion resistance of the wear-resistant layer 32 can be enhanced; and further, the silicon elements are added in the material and synergistically act with the carbon, chromium and manganese elements, so that the high-temperature oxidation resistance of the wear-resistant layer 32 can be enhanced.

[0033] According to the above description, the following compares examples with comparative examples to further illustrate the specific effect differences of the wear resistance, corrosion resistance and high-temperature oxidation resistance brought by the different elements and contents of the wear-resistant layer 32. It should be noted that in the following table, S refers to the example, and D refers to the comparative example.

[0034] Firstly, for the index of wear resistance,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 can be worn by a wear device for a certain period of time, and the volume loss of the wear-resistant layer 32 is detected. The smaller the loss, the better the wear resistance.

[0035]

[0036] Table 1 As shown in Table 1, the difference between the examples and the comparative examples is that the content of manganese element is different, and the contents of other elements are the same. As can be seen from Table 1, the volume loss of the wear-resistant layer 32 in examples S1-S3 is much smaller than the corresponding volume loss in comparative examples D1-D3. That is, when the content of manganese element is in the range of 0.5-1.5%, the wear-resistant layer 32 formed by the cooperation of manganese, carbon, chromium and silicon elements has better wear resistance.

[0037] Secondly, for the index of corrosion resistance,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 can be placed in a corrosion environment, and the time of first rust appearance of the wear-resistant layer 32 is detected. The longer the time of first rust appearance, the better the corrosion resistance.

[0038]

[0039] Table 2 As shown in Table 2, the difference between the examples and the comparative examples is that the contents of manganese and chromium elements are different, and the contents of other elements are the same. As can be seen from Table 2, the time of first rust appearance of the wear-resistant layer 32 in examples S4-S6 is much greater than the corresponding time of first rust appearance in comparative examples D4-D6. That is, when the content of manganese element is in the range of 0.5-1.5% and the content of chromium element is in the range of 25-30%, the wear-resistant layer 32 formed by the cooperation of manganese, carbon and silicon elements has better corrosion resistance.

[0040] Next, for the index of high-temperature oxidation resistance,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 can be placed in a high-temperature environment (for example, the temperature can be above 650°C in the first stage of chain grate preheating) for a certain period of time, and the unit area mass change of the wear-resistant layer 32 is detected. The smaller the unit area mass change, the better the high-temperature oxidation resistance.

[0041]

[0042] Table 3 See Table 3, wherein the difference between the examples and the comparative examples is that the content of silicon element is different, and the content of the remaining elements is the same. As can be seen from Table 3, the change amount of the unit area mass of the wear-resistant layer 32 in Examples S7-S9 is far less than the corresponding unit area mass change amount in Comparative Examples D7-D9. That is to say, when the content of silicon element is within the range of 0.5-1.5%, the high-temperature oxidation resistance of the wear-resistant layer 32 formed by the cooperation of silicon element, carbon, chromium and manganese is better.

[0043] It should be noted that when the content of carbon is 3-4.5%, the content of chromium is 25-30%, the content of manganese is 0.5-1.5%, and the content of silicon is 0.5-1.5%, the hardness of the wear-resistant layer 32 formed is 58-65 HRC, which can make the overall structural stability of the impeller better.

[0044] Please continue to combine Figures 1-3 , specifically, the impeller body 10 includes a flange plate 11, a middle plate 12, an edge plate 13 and a plurality of blades 14. The flange plate 11 is used to connect with the main shaft of the centrifugal fan, the middle plate 12 is fixedly sleeved on the outer periphery of the flange plate 11, and the edge plate 13 is arranged opposite and coaxially with the middle plate 12; the plurality of blades 14 are arranged at intervals along the circumferential direction of the middle plate 12, and the two ends of each blade 14 are connected with the middle plate 12 and the edge plate 13 respectively. Among them, the surfaces of the middle plate 12 and the plurality of blades 14 are provided with wear-resistant composite steel plates 30.

[0045] That is to say, the surface of the middle plate 12 is sequentially provided with a base layer 31 and a wear-resistant layer 32, and the surface of the blade 14 is also sequentially provided with a base layer 31 and a wear-resistant layer 32, which can better protect the blade 14 and the middle plate 12, thereby improving the service life of the impeller body 10.

[0046] Combine Figure 3 , in order to facilitate the installation of the blade 14 and the middle plate 12, and further improve the overall structural strength of the impeller body 10, in the embodiment,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 on the blade 14 is provided with a clamping groove 34 at one end close to the middle plate 12, and the clamping groove 34 is clamped and matched with the middle plate 12.

[0047] Combine Figure 1 and Figure 2 , in order to facilitate the connection of the flange plate 11 and the main shaft, the impeller body 10 further comprises a flange 15, the flange 15 is arranged on the flange plate 11, and the flange 15 is provided with a mounting hole for butt joint assembly with the main shaft.

[0048] Further, in the embodiment, the base layer 31 is arranged on the windward surface 141 of the blade 14, and the wear-resistant layer 32 is arranged on the side of the base layer 31 away from the windward surface 141. Through such arrangement, the blade 14 can be better protected during rotation, thereby improving its service life and improving the overall structural strength of the impeller body 10.

[0049] Further, in the embodiment,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 is arranged on the opposite sides of the middle disc 12, so that the middle disc 12 can be better protected as a whole, thereby improving the overall wear resistance, corrosion resistance and high-temperature oxidation resistance of the impeller body 10.

[0050] It should be noted that the flow channel for airflow circulation is jointly formed between the edge disc 13, the middle disc 12 and the two adjacent blades 14. Optionally, in the embodiment, the number of the edge disc 13 is two, and the two edge discs 13 are arranged on the opposite sides of the middle disc 12.

[0051] That is, the impeller body 10 in the embodiment has a double-inlet structure, and the gas can be sucked from both sides of the impeller body 10 at the same time and then discharged from the outer periphery of the impeller body 10 after converging. Of course, in other embodiments, the number of the edge disc 13 can also be one, that is, the impeller body 10 has a single-inlet structure.

[0052] Optionally, the middle disc 12, the edge disc 13 and the plurality of blades 14 are all made of steel. Specifically, in the embodiment, the middle disc 12, the edge disc 13 and the plurality of blades 14 are all made of HG70 steel, which has the characteristics of high strength, good toughness and good fatigue resistance.

[0053] It should be noted that the base layer 31 is made of carbon steel. Optionally, in the embodiment, the base layer 31 is made of Q345 carbon steel, which has the characteristics of high yield strength and good low-temperature toughness.

[0054] In addition, it should be noted that the connection mode between the middle disc 12, the edge disc 13 and the plurality of blades 14 in the embodiment is welding, and the welding rod used is J707RH high-strength steel welding rod.

[0055] Further, the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 is installed by plug welding, and the welding wire used in the welding process is VAUTID 100T wear-resistant welding wire, which has good wear resistance below 600°C.

[0056] Please continue to combine Figure 3 The w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 is provided with a plurality of plug welding holes 33, and the plug welding holes 33 are arranged at intervals. Optionally, the diameter of the plug welding hole 33 is 13-15 mm; for example, the diameter can be 13 mm, 13.5 mm, 14 mm, 14.5 mm or 15 mm, etc.

[0057] Optionally, the distance between the plug welding hole 33 close to the edge of the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 and the edge of the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 is 70-90 mm; for example, the distance can be 70 mm, 75 mm, 80 mm, 85 mm or 90 mm, etc.

[0058] Optionally, the distance between two adjacent plug welding holes 33 is 100-150 mm; for example, the distance can be 100 mm, 110 mm, 120 mm, 130 mm, 140 mm, or 150 mm, etc.

[0059] It should be noted that the wear-resistant composite steel plate 30 is selected from the above parameter range, and the welding effect is better, which can further improve the overall structural stability of the centrifugal fan impeller 100.

[0060] In addition, optionally, in the embodiment, the thickness of the base layer 31 is 6-10 mm; for example, the thickness of the base layer 31 can be 6 mm, 7 mm, 8 mm, 9 mm, or 10 mm, etc. The thickness of the wear-resistant layer 32 is 4-8 mm, for example, the thickness of the wear-resistant layer 32 can be 4 mm, 5 mm, 6 mm, 7 mm, or 8 mm, etc.
